Aperçu de l’installation
Déjà suivi Pour commencer ? Vous êtes prêt — cette page est destinée aux méthodes alternatives d’installation, aux instructions spécifiques à la plate-forme et à la maintenance.Configuration requise
- Node 22+ (le script d’installation l’installera s’il est manquant)
- macOS, Linux ou Windows
pnpmuniquement si vous compilez depuis les sources
Sous Windows, nous recommandons fortement d’exécuter OpenClaw sous WSL2.
Choisir votre méthode d’installation
Installer script
Installer script
Télécharge la CLI, l’installe globalement via npm et lance l’assistant de prise en main.C’est tout — le script gère la détection de Node, l’installation et la prise en main.Pour ignorer la prise en main et simplement installer le binaire :Pour tous les flags, variables d’environnement et options CI/automatisation, consultez Installer internals.
- macOS / Linux / WSL2
- Windows (PowerShell)
- macOS / Linux / WSL2
- Windows (PowerShell)
npm / pnpm
npm / pnpm
Si vous disposez déjà de Node 22+ et préférez gérer l’installation vous-même :
- npm
- pnpm
erreurs de build sharp ?
erreurs de build sharp ?
Si libvips est installé globalement (courant sur macOS via Homebrew) et que Si vous voyez
sharp échoue, forcez les binaires précompilés :sharp: Please add node-gyp to your dependencies, installez les outils de build (macOS : Xcode CLT + npm install -g node-gyp) ou utilisez la variable d’environnement ci-dessus.From source
From source
Pour les contributeurs ou toute personne souhaitant exécuter depuis un dépôt local.Pour des workflows de développement plus avancés, consultez Setup.
Clone and build
Clonez le dépôt OpenClaw repo et compilez :
Link the CLI
Rendez la commande Sinon, ignorez le lien et exécutez les commandes via
openclaw disponible globalement :pnpm openclaw ... depuis le dépôt.Autres options d’installation
Docker
Déploiements confinés ou sans interface graphique.
Podman
Conteneur rootless : exécutez
setup-podman.sh une fois, puis le script de lancement.Nix
Installation déclarative via Nix.
Ansible
Provisionnement automatisé de flotte.
Bun
Utilisation CLI uniquement via le runtime Bun.
Après l’installation
Vérifiez que tout fonctionne :OPENCLAW_HOMEpour les chemins internes basés sur le répertoire personnelOPENCLAW_STATE_DIRpour l’emplacement de l’état mutableOPENCLAW_CONFIG_PATHpour l’emplacement du fichier de configuration
Dépannage : openclaw introuvable
PATH diagnosis and fix
PATH diagnosis and fix
Diagnostic rapide :Si Sous Windows, ajoutez la sortie de
$(npm prefix -g)/bin (macOS/Linux) ou $(npm prefix -g) (Windows) n’est pas présent dans votre $PATH, votre shell ne peut pas trouver les binaires npm globaux (y compris openclaw).Correctif — ajoutez-le à votre fichier de démarrage du shell (~/.zshrc ou ~/.bashrc) :npm prefix -g à votre PATH.Puis ouvrez un nouveau terminal (ou rehash dans zsh / hash -r dans bash).Mise à jour / désinstallation
Updating
Maintenez OpenClaw à jour.
Migrating
Déplacer vers une nouvelle machine.
Uninstall
Supprimez complètement OpenClaw.